Output 43d660230712bebe7d46c8e84529d791654a55bc10132f7fe9e0a8cc0a5cda40:1

value
17921147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0167c7f7b7b7d2f133c2d0eb0e16846d4ce9725 OP_EQUAL
address
MUL2Xn2VR5CVySuoCEuUstyPPgSpL4wjv6
transaction
43d660230712bebe7d46c8e84529d791654a55bc10132f7fe9e0a8cc0a5cda40
spent
true